33: warm up the chicken

My mom sells grocery cards at the church. The basic idea is that people buy grocery cards (and then groceries), and the company donates money to the church. It's an extremely successful campaign, as everyone needs groceries and no one is asked to make a personal donation in lieu of food. To advertise these cards, my mom wears a straw hat with a rubber chicken tied to the crown. In the summer, the chicken wore a bikini. But she's been cold for months...

Enter my various "clothing the chicken" schemes. First I tried a sweater, but it turned into too much of a committment. So I downsized to accessories.


bawk!

The hat is a nosewarmer. The scarf is a 5-stitch garter stitch wonder. The most cool thing is that both those yarns were left over from big hats (Blake's & Nic's). The debut is this week.
